Government daycare assistance for single moms is something every single mother should look at.One of the biggest issues for single mothers is trying to find safe and secure daycare or after school programs for their children. Most of the child day care programs that are available have very long waiting lists. And there are not very many people out there that will babysit for free. If you are looking for government daycare assistance for single moms this is an article for you.The internet is a great way to find out about programs that provide government daycare assistance for single mothers. While there are a lot of programs that have information on the internet, the number one place people should look for single mother’s government assistance for daycare should be their work place.Yes, it’s true the government offers grants to companies that provide their employees with  at work child care options and even financial assistance for offsite daycare programs. You might even be able to find information on government daycare assistance for single moms in your own employee handbook.And it’s not just for single women; anyone seeking help with childcare can qualify.Another great place to look for government daycare assistance for single moms is your local social services office. The social workers that work there will know which daycare programs offer deals to single mothers looking for government assistance for daycare, and might also be able to help that person apply for financial aid. Financial aid programs will give the person or single mother money to help pay for daycare services. Single mother’s government assistance for daycare can also be found in churches. Churches can also qualify for government daycare assistance for single mothers if they offer daycare that’s affordable to those who really need it.You can also look into your local area, state, and federal websites to find government daycare assistance for single moms.
